Beaverton sits just west of Portland’s core and hosts a dense cluster of innovation hubs. The Intel Beaverton campus, Nike’s headquarters, and a growing network of SaaS startups keep the talent pipeline steady. Employees enjoy a blend of high‑pay tech roles and the convenience of Portland‑style coffee shops, bike lanes, and easy access to the Columbia River.
Tech talent here ranges from hardware engineers at Intel and semiconductor designers for advanced AI chips, to data scientists optimizing Nike’s supply chain, to software developers building SaaS products for local health and sustainability startups. The area also attracts automotive tech firms and remote‑first companies that value the city’s high‑speed fiber network.
Housing prices in Beaverton average $650,000, and the median rent is about $1,700 per month. With living costs above the national average, knowing exact salary ranges lets candidates negotiate salaries that cover both tech perks and the local cost of living.
